In late April 2004, photographs taken in the Iraqi Abu Ghraib prison and electronically shared among American troops were leaked, causing outrage around the world. The images showed American military personnel torturing, humiliating, and sexu-ally abusing Iraqi detainees, in some cases to the point of mur-der, in flagrant violation of the Geneva Conventions. During the first half of the nineteenth century, some fundamental insights into pollen morphology and physiology were achieved. Purkinje made the first attempt for a palynological terminology by classifying pollen based on their morphology (Purkinje 1830).
